Top Rooftop Bars in Asheville

The Montford Rooftop Bar

Perched atop the 8-floor of DoubleTree by Hilton Asheville Downtown, this rooftop has stellar mountain views from the outdoor terrace or indoor bar. Enjoy the sunset while savoring a cocktail and sampling small bites from the local, seasonal menu. Open daily at 4 PM with free valet parking. 199 Haywood Street

Hemingway's Cuba

You don't have to travel to Havana to enjoy a night in Cuba; just go to Hemingway’s Cuba! Menu favorites include Empanadas, Tostones Board, Ropa Vieja and Vaca Frita or enjoy a classic Cuban Sandwich. Or sip on a Cuban Daiquiri and gaze out over Downtown Asheville and the Blue Ridge Mountains from their amazing rooftop. 15 Page Avenue, 4th Floor

Pillar Rooftop Bar

Atop the Hilton Garden Inn at the corner of Charlotte and College streets, this “garden-to-glass” bar offers signature craft cocktails, regional beers and sustainable wines. Enjoy the southern fusion cuisine, sharing small plates and sipping cocktails with views of the Blue Ridge Mountains. Easy walk from Pack Square Park. 309 College Street

Capella on 9

This large rooftop bar offers views of Asheville’s cityscape and surrounding mountains, an ideal setting to unwind and take it in. Order drinks and enjoy small plates from the tapas-style menu.  Enter through the hotel lobby on Broadway and take the elevator to the 9th. 10 Broadway

The Social Lounge

This cozy rooftop patio has been a longtime local favorite with a front row view of the bustling city below. It's owned by Chef Anthony Cerrato, who also owns Strada Italian next door.Enjoy an array of cocktails blended from fine liquors and house-made elixirs, international wines and local beers on tap. Their small plates are designed to share. 29 Broadway Street
